Wealthy families enroll kids in AI-run schools

By Meridian48 News Desk · Summarised from The Verge AI ·

Some wealthy American families are opting for AI-led education from startups like Forge Prep and Alpha, bypassing traditional schools. These programs use AI tutors to personalize learning, though critics question their effectiveness and social development impact. The trend highlights a growing divide in educational approaches among the rich.
